Cobalis' EU Patent for PreHistin(R) Becomes Effective; Patent Protects Method of Treatment for Cobalis' PreHistin Anti-Allergy Medication

By: FRESH news

Cobalis Corp. (OTC BB: CLSC), a pharmaceutical development company focused on the treatment of allergy and other atopic conditions, announced today that its Patent No. 1128835, titled "Cyanocobalamin Treatment in Allergic Disease," has been published by the European Patent Office in the European Patent Bulletin 06/25. With its publication today, the patent is now in effect and protects the method of treatment underlying Cobalis' PreHistin(R) anti-allergy medication.

The European patent represents an important extension of Cobalis' patent portfolio consisting of patents issued in the U.S. and Australia and patents pending in Japan, Canada and Mexico. An estimated 36 million people suffer from seasonal allergies in the European countries of France, Germany, Italy, Spain and the United Kingdom.

PreHistin is a sublingual lozenge containing an allergy-opposing amount of Cyanocobalamin that is absorbed through the buccal membrane, allowing direct introduction into the bloodstream. It is believed that PreHistin may reduce the release of symptom causing histamine and other allergic inflammatory mediators into the body. PreHistin potentially offers an alternative to anti-histamines, which generally are taken after the onset of symptoms and can be sedating or have undesirable side affects.
